Understanding Insurance Loss Draft Inspections: What They Are and Why They Matter

When property damage occurs, whether due to natural disasters, fire, or other major incidents, insurance companies issue loss draft checks to help cover the cost of repairs. But before those funds are released to homeowners or contractors, Insurance Loss Draft Inspections play a critical role in protecting all parties involved, including mortgage servicers, insurers, and …

GIS Reaffirms Its Commitment to the NAMFS Pricing Pledge

As the National Association of Mortgage Field Services (NAMFS) continues to work toward its Pricing Pledge, an ongoing initiative to enhance compensation for property inspections and preservation work, GIS Field Services remains committed to these efforts—and aims to take them even further. GIS signed the NAMFS Pricing Pledge in 2022, agreeing to share all allowable …
